The value of lobbying for democracy and growth in Italy

Lobbying in many countries is a trasparent, regulated activity which is recognized as a necessary and indeed healthy part of the democratic process. In Italy lobbying is difficult to extricate from the opaque influence-peddling and pernicious business&politics overlap that so characterises much of what passes for democratic decision-making. Does the new Italian political zeitgeist provide an opportunity for il lobbismo to venture out from under its rock? The panel will take as its starting-point the book Lobbying&Lobbismi, le regole del gioco in una democrazia reale (2012) by Gianluca Sgueo.
